Output 27a05886a5fa130394967c0936fc4f8f20804926a5ef2c8cf4d73a6b309fbcf1:0

value
767226
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 baffd3b254efed6b32ee5da45db98daa8d9a2258acfc54125b73d0df0a507f66
address
bc1phtla8vj5alkkkvhwtkj9mwvd42xe5gjc4n79gyjmw0gd7zjs0anq77d98g
transaction
27a05886a5fa130394967c0936fc4f8f20804926a5ef2c8cf4d73a6b309fbcf1
confirmations
2032
spent
false